Paperback. Condition: 2007. A very good copy. In 1972 Nixon amazed the world by going to China. The first trip ever by a US President was an immense gamble but a brilliant stroke of policy. It marked the end of deep freeze in Sino-American relations and changed the international balance of power for ever. This book deals with the story of Nixon, Mao and the week that changed the world.
